Output 76bf322efee41a339b65c17ad86e7edd7dc083f73aaa253cbc36cf2054d83c14:0

value
57898163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d84c26390aad03566a7e21eb412e9dcb0b3bae OP_EQUAL
address
39t5BE9fCRecAxUcuZuFEgjmnWfbZcupSG
transaction
76bf322efee41a339b65c17ad86e7edd7dc083f73aaa253cbc36cf2054d83c14
confirmations
357969
spent
true